Neil is going to share some Sassy Tips with us to get you on the right track for a very successful Wedding Ceremony and Wedding Reception.   Sassy Tip #01: Grandma Leaves Early. Yep...that's Sassy Tip #01. Kind of brilliant isn't it? Neil points out just how important it is to know your demographics. I'll save most of his secrets for you to hear in The Podcast, but I really thought it was brilliant when he pointed out that Grandma leaves the wedding earlier than most of the other guests. So to make sure you have a fun party for all...start out with the more traditional "oldies" that most people, including Grandma, would be able to connect with. This gets the emotion of the party stirring early on in the event.   Sassy Tip #02: An iTunes Tip for DIYers. Basically what Neil shares with us here in the Podcast is that a DIY DJ Tip is to create an iTunes Playlist for each and every moment of the Wedding. From the Prelude List to the Bouquet Tossing List...have a step-by-step guide, using iTunes, to set the music to meet the mood of the event. This trick helps you avoid getting lost or overlooking an event. And, you have the music for each event right there at your fingertips in an organized system. Sassy Tip #1: Make sure you get servers to work your reception. Servers that have worked with food in the past is best. It's really important, if you are having a buffet, to make sure that you have servers to fill the plates of your guests. This will ensure that your guests don't overload their plates and then you run out of food before all of your guests have gone through the buffet line. One of the worst things that can happen at a wedding reception is to run out of food....so hiring servers will help with this potential issue.   Sassy Tip #2:  Never ask your guests to help clean up your reception area. Once again, hiring servers will make this a very special occasion.   Sassy Tip #3: Check with your venue to ensure that they will allow you to bring in your own food. Some venues have a list of "preferred vendors" and they will only allow these pre-approved vendors to work your event. Some locations have a list of requirements, including certain insurance requirements, before a vendor will be allowed to work at the location.   Sassy Tip #4:  Find out from your venue how many hours in advance  you are allowed to set up your kitchen. Also, how many hours are you given to break down the event. And, what are your clean up expectations.   Sassy Tip #5: Check with a Caterer and see if you can hire them for consulting you on catering your own wedding. But, at the end of the day you want to look back at your wedding and know that you did what YOU wanted to do. Sassy Tip #2: Fresh Flowers are not always more expensive than permanent botanicals. Some people think that permanent botanicals are much cheaper than fresh flowers and this is just not true...unless you are buying very cheap/inexpensive permanent botanicals. Example: A fresh rose can be purchased from Bishop's Flowers on a cash and carry basis for $3. If you special order a particular rose or color, it can usually be purchased for $5 per rose. Sassy Tip #1: Know where you want to go and when you want to go. You have to plan your trips long in advance because many places sell out. So, reserve your places early on to avoid disappointment. Knowing the seasons at different locations will also help you save money. The Caribbean, The Mediterranean and Hawaii are the three most popular places for Honeymoon Travel. If you are departing from the United States, The Caribbean offers the best packages with the best prices. If you're on a budget: plan early!   Sassy Tip #2:  Get your documents in order early. Cruise Lines won't let you complete your boarding process or complete your logging in process until you have completed your Immigration information. Brides...make sure your legal name on your Passport, Driver's License, Tickets, etc. all match.
